Psychoanalytic
The psychoanalytic approach is a theory and therapeutic method developed by Sigmund Freud that emphasizes unconscious processes and conflicts as the root of psychological distress and behavior.
Rational-emotive
A form of psychotherapy that identifies irrational beliefs and challenges them to help improve emotional well-being.
Rational-emotive Therapy
A form of therapy that emphasizes changing irrational beliefs to overcome emotional distress and behavioral issues.
Ellis
Refers to Albert Ellis, an American psychologist who developed Rational Emotive Behavior Therapy (REBT), a significant precursor to cognitive-behavioral therapies.
